Texas 2013 - 83rd Regular

Texas House Bill HR2401

Caption

Honoring Democratic Party precinct chair Robert Price of Precinct 2302 in Tarrant County.

Summary

HR2401 is a resolution honoring Robert Price for his distinguished service as the Democratic Party precinct chair of Precinct 2302 in Tarrant County. The resolution acknowledges the critical role that precinct chairs play in the electoral process, highlighting their efforts to galvanize voter support and ensure the representation of working families in a democratic society. It emphasizes the necessity for active voter engagement in public policy, thereby promoting civic responsibility among citizens.
